    Maam when calculating Value in Use, we are neither allowed to include revenue expenditure nor capital expenditure?

    For eg. any revenue expenditure incurred to restore the asset to its original condition(after damage) is not allowed? I understand that capital expenditure incurred to increase the useful life of the asset or productivity of the asset are not allowed.

    You can’t include any further expenditure regardless of how it is accounted for – if only revenue/capital expense excluded you could include the cost of major repairs and renewals that didn’t qualify to be accounted for as a major overhaul, for example.
